Transaction 9518b7a1dfd93890e924d8a357c36b0176a615aa33a2da8f82af4c54873eb349

block
c64f81ba36e925bc67a33d0cff3a50095cf80c7b67685310ba9c54ce311d5518

68 Inputs

2 Outputs